Legal Fellow, Clean Air Protection

Environmental Defense Fund is a leading organization focused on clean air protection and climate change mitigation. The Legal Fellow will engage in regulatory advocacy, conduct legal research, and support initiatives aimed at reducing air pollution and ensuring accountability from federal agencies. This role involves drafting documents, participating in hearings, and contributing to environmental justice efforts.

Responsibilities

Conduct legal and factual research on climate and energy issues
Evaluate the implications of White House and federal agency actions, or court decisions, on climate, clean air, and clean energy policies
Seek and evaluate government records, utilizing FOIA and other transparency tools, to assess the impact of federal government activities on climate, clean air, and clean energy objectives
Draft public-facing documents such as fact sheets and blog posts about legal issues
Represent EDF at public hearings before government agencies
Engage in regulatory and administrative proceedings, and provide other support to the team's litigation efforts and regulatory advocacy
Support environmental justice initiatives, particularly those related to addressing the disparate impacts of climate change and energy systems
